Orange Cardamom Olive Oil Cake

Delicious cake from Trista

Ingredients

  • 4 eggs
  • 1 1/4 cups sugar
  • 3/4 cup olive oil
  • 3/4 cup orange juice
  • 1 tablespoon orange zest (finely grated)
  • 1/2 teaspoon vanilla
  • 2 teaspoon almond extract
  • 1 cup gluten-free all-purpose flour
  • 1 cup almond flour
  • 1 1/2 teaspoons baking powder
  • 3/4 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1 teaspoon cardamom
  • 3/4 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 cup sugar
  • 1/4 cup orange juice
  • a pinch sea salt
  • 1.5 - 2 cups heavy cream
  • 3 tbsp powdered sugar
  • 1/2 tsp vanilla extract
  • 1/2 tsp cardamom
  • powdered sugar

Cookware

  • 9-inch springform pan

Steps

Cake

  1. Preheat the oven to 350°F.

  2. Grease a 9-inch springform pan lined with parchment.

  3. Whisk the eggs and sugar in a large bowl until light in color. Add the olive oil, orange juice, orange zest, vanilla and almond extract and stir to blend.

  4. Combine the gluten-free all-purpose flour, almond flour, baking powder, baking soda, cardamom, and salt in a separate bowl.

  5. Add to the wet ingredients, stirring to blend without over-mixing. Pour into the prepared pan. Let rest for 10 minutes to let the flour hydrate.

  6. Bake until the cake is golden brown and a toothpick inserted into the center comes clean, about 40 minutes.

Glaze

  1. While the cake is baking, prepare the glaze. Combine the sugar and orange juice in a small saucepan.

  2. Simmer until the sugar dissolves and the liquid reduces to a syrupy consistency, about 2 minutes, stirring constantly.

  3. Add the sea salt and simmer 1 minute, stirring frequently.

  4. Transfer the cake from the oven to a wire rack. Brush the top with the glaze and cool 10 minutes.

  5. Remove the sides of the pan, then brush the cake on the sides with the glaze. Cool completely.

Topping

  1. Whip heavy cream until medium peaks form add powdered sugar, vanilla extract and cardamom.

  2. Dust cake with powdered sugar and top with whipped cream.
